The purpose of making an estate plan anchor is to make sure that your assets are dispersed according to your dreams after you die and to minimize taxes, while additionally attending to decisions in the event of incapacity.
The will need to be signed by the manufacturer and has to be experienced by two witnesses in the special fashion given by legislation - Estate Planning Attorney. After death, the will is provided in court and, after being verified legitimate, is placed into effect and its stipulations are brought out.
A will certainly may be revoked or changed at any type of time prior to death as long as the manufacturer is legitimately competent. Transforming a will also calls for two witnesses. That should get your home, and, if children, at what age? That should be called administrator? That should be called as guardians of small kids, and what are their responsibilities? Should a trust fund be created for your partner, kids or others? If a trust is developed, you need to call a competent person or count on firm to handle the trust fund.

A will can conserve expenditure by eliminating the requirement for guaranties on bonds, quickening the sale of residential or commercial property, staying clear of guardianship for minors where not actually necessary, and otherwise offering the executor of the will with clear directions on handling of the estate.
A person without a Will has no voice in the choice of the manager. If there is a will, the administrator chosen by the manufacturer of the will certainly takes the area of a manager and is the one that takes care of the estate. An individual making the will certainly might choose as executor any type of private in whom he or she has confidence provided the executor satisfies statutory requirements.
A will certainly permits you to state to whom property will certainly be moved after your death. If there is no will, the home is transferred to your successors pursuant to the state law. If there is an enduring spouse and one Clicking Here or even more kids, the surviving partner gets fifty percent and the children share similarly in the other fifty percent.
A will lets you offer your residential or commercial property to individuals of your choice. A will certainly also enables you the opportunity to nominate the specific or individuals whom you would certainly such as the court to designate as guardian of your youngsters. A will must be prepared while you remain in healthiness and in a position to very carefully consider its provisions.
